I received a call from some legal service stating that I will be arrested at my job or my place of residence if I do not pay a loan that I received. How can they do that when I have never received any such loan? Plus, to my understanding, you need direct deposit at your bank in order to receive a payday loan of any kind.
Inform the legal service that you never took out this loan; if they don't back down at that point, ask them to send you whatever documentation or evidence they claim to have showing that you did take out the loan, so you can review it and show them that it was not you; let them know that if they continue to pursue you for a loan which is not yours, you will take all appropriate legal action, which may include seeking to press charges for harassment or extortion.

The answer to the "can I sue" question is always yes. However, if you sue and do not have a valid claim, the defendant can give you notice under rule 11 asserting that your claim is a frivolous one. If you refuse to dismiss the case, and the court determines that your claim was frivolous, you will owe money to the defendant...

Some states, like Oregon, place practically no restrictions on payday loans, while other states ban them entirely. The regulations of your state have a huge effect on what lenders can charge. As a borrower, it’s important for you to be aware of these regulations and to make sure your loan has the right terms and fees dictated by law.
The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B) no longer requires lenders to consider your ability to repay a loan. This could put you at risk of getting caught in a cycle of debt. Carefully review your finances and the loan cost to make sure it fits your budget.

The Annual Percentage Rate, or APR, is one of the main costs you need to consider with a payday loan. In most states that regulate payday loans, you’ll find the APR is restricted. Otherwise, a lender may be able to charge as much as it wants. Make sure you know the total cost of a loan before you borrow.
Payday loans are meant to last until your next payday. This means that a typical loan term will be two to four weeks, and many states have minimum and maximum terms. The length of your loan has a huge impact on the amount of interest you’ll end up paying.
